[{"type":"text","content":"New Award to Develop Foundry-Compatible Quantum Materials Leveraging Aeluma's Large-Scale Semiconductor TechnologyGOLETA, CA / ACCESSWIRE / February 8, 2024 / Aeluma, Inc. (OTCQB:ALMU), a semiconductor company specializing in scalable, cost-effective technologies for LiDAR (light detection and ranging), communication, and sensing, announced today that it has been awarded funding from the U.S. Office of Secretary of Defense to develop foundry-scale, CMOS-compatible quantum materials.\"Aeluma's core technology combines high-performance semiconductors with cost-effective, scalable manufacturing,\" said Aeluma's Director of Technology, Matthew Dummer, Ph.D. \"This funding award provides further validation that our technology and offerings are broadly applicable and that demand for high-performance semiconductors is high.\"Aeluma recently announced two wins to apply its technology to defense and aerospace applications. These achievements are important for recognition purposes, as well as the revenue they generate for Aeluma. While the company continues to market to large-volume, emerging commercial applications including automotive and mobile, these early awards hint at other potential large-scale applications of its ground-breaking technology. The award announced today focuses on quantum and communication applications, with particular emphasis on scaling to be compatible with large-diameter substrates and CMOS manufacturing, themes that are central to Aeluma's pioneering technology.About Aeluma, Inc.Aeluma (www.aeluma.com) develops novel optoelectronics for sensing and communication applications. Aeluma has pioneered a technique to manufacture semiconductor chips using high-performance compound semiconductor materials on large-diameter substrates that are commonly used for mass-market microelectronics. The technology has the potential to enhance performance and scale manufacturing, both of which are critical for emerging applications. Aeluma is developing a streamlined business model from its headquarters in Santa Barbara, California that has a state-of-the-art manufacturing cleanroom. Its transformative semiconductor chip technology may impact a variety of markets including automotive LiDAR, mobile, defense & aerospace, AR/VR, AI, quantum, and communication.
